I brought my car to the dealer because after counting down miles the SERVICE! indicator came on. This indicator is never correct but I wanted the message to go away. The dealer confirmed that I wasn't due for service for another 5K miles so he said that the indicator would be reset. After the "service" I made a couple of short trips and the SERVICE! indicator came back on. I called the service advisor and he said that since I was more than half-way to needing service, this is perfectly normal. In other words, my car will need service in 5 months (at the rate I drive) so I'm reminded of this practically every time I put the car into Drive. I called Audi customer service and the rep there concurred with this. I'll mark it on my calendar for December. Wait, the lease is up in December. UGH.

Replying to: gabby10 (Aug 04, 2007 10:17 am) AUDI USA should be banned from being able to do business in this country. They do not support their customer and, worse yet, treat their dealer network not much better. They have "bob and weave", "ooooh I love a side step" , "not my problem" and "tell someone who cares" down to a science. They knowingly outfitted certain production of the 03 A6 4.2 Quattro with 16 inch wheels and tires (carry over from an A4 design) that did not have the ride capability, steering control and wear characteristics necessary to support the weight of that vehicle. They quietly switched to 17" in a running change that year and have denied that there was ever a problem. Result for consumer is constant rotation of tires every 3000 miles, redoing alignment every 10,000 and STILL have the tires "cup" and "rumble" about 8-10,000 miles and be worn out at 15,000. I will be dumping this PIG before warranty expires.
